Council heard first readings for two ordinances authorizing the director of public service to apply for OWDA funding for the Adrianne/Patty/Gerard reconstruction project, with preliminary estimates of about $800,000 for sewer and $1.5 million for water.

Council on Feb. 3 gave first reading to two ordinances that would authorize the director of public service to apply for Ohio Water Development Authority (OWDA) funding for the Adrianne, Patty and Gerard reconstruction project.
